Bought a 3 pound / 1.35 kilogram plastic container of New Jersey USA made
Biazzo brand Whole Milk Ricotta Cheese from SamsClub wholesale store here in Houston Texas for USD5.73.
Container labelling says:
- Ingredients are Pasteurized whole milk, whey, vinegar, & salt.
- Best if used within 3 days of unsealing.
- Stamp on bottom that best by August 14, 2009, 3.5 months from today.
Under lid there was a safety sheet of transparent plastic, with very little air between it and the cheese, presumably once open to air, cheese starts to degrade.
When "stirred" with spoon it has, when frigerator cold, the consistency of soft ice cream. Light scent and flavour, tastes great on crackers.
